Let CM, Dy CMs, RSS chief get spades and shovels to fulfil their people's wishes: Sanjay Raut
Mumbai, March 18: A day after the violence in Maharashtra's Nagpur over the demand for the demolition of Aurangzeb's grave, Shiv Sena(UBT) MP Sanjay Raut on Tuesday said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is, Deputy Chief Ministers Eknath Shinde and Ajit Pawar, and RSS chief Mohan Bhagwat should take up spades and shovels and fulfil the wishes of “their” people.
SP leader Abu Azmi faces backlash for calling Aurangzeb 'not a cruel ruler'
Mumbai, March 3: Maharashtra Samajwadi Party (SP) leader Abu Azmi has come under fire for his remarks defending Mughal ruler Aurangzeb Alamgir, stating that he was “not a cruel leader”. His comments have sparked controversy, drawing sharp criticism from political leaders across party lines.
Laadle Mashak Dargah controversy resurfaces: Karnataka court permits Shivling worship on Mahashivratri
Kalaburagi, Feb 25 : The controversy surrounding the worship of the Raghava Chaitanya Shivling, installed within the premises of the Laadle Mashak Dargah, has resurfaced during Mahashivratri in Kalaburagi district of Karnataka.
